抄録

The magnetization process and microstructure of FePt (001) films with large perpendicular magnetic anisotropy were analyzed. The sample films were synthesized by co-sputtering Pt and Fe directly onto heated single crystalline MgO (001) substrates using a high vacuum multiple dc-sputtering system. The structural characteristics of the films were investigated using transmission electron microscopy and x-ray diffraction with Cu-Kα radiation. The results show that the value of uniaxial magnetic anisotropy is constant although the magnetic domain structure changes from single-to multidomain state, and thus show that magnetization process depends on the film morphology.
